Download presentation
Presentation is loading. Please wait.
1
Excel 2007 操作培训—常用函数应用
2
本次课程主要内容 函数的基础知识 1 人力资源工作总结与计划 1 2 2 行政工作总结与计划 常用函数应用技巧
3
第一章 函数的基础知识 1.1 公式中的运算符 1.2 单元格的引用 1.3 函数的输入与编辑 1.4 函数的分类
4
第一章 函数的基础知识 1.1 公式中的运算符 算术运算符 比较运算符 算数运算符 说明 + 加法 - 减法 * 乘法 / 除法 % 百分比
1.1 公式中的运算符 算术运算符 比较运算符 算数运算符 说明 + 加法 - 减法 * 乘法 / 除法 % 百分比 ^ 乘方 比较运算符 说明 = 等号 > 大于号 < 小于号 >= 大于等于号 <= 小于等于号 <> 不等号 IBM Confidential
5
第一章 函数的基础知识 1.1 公式中的运算符 文本运算符 引用运算符 文本运算符 说明 & 多个文本字符串,组合成一个文本显示 引用运算符
公式中的运算符 文本运算符 引用运算符 文本运算符 说明 & 多个文本字符串,组合成一个文本显示 引用运算符 说明 ,(逗号) 引用不相邻的多个单元格 :(冒号) 引用相邻的多个单元格 (空格) 引用选定的多个单元格的交叉区域 IBM Confidential
6
第一章 函数的基础知识 1.1 公式中的运算符 运算符优先级 优先级 运算种类 1 % 2 ^ 3 *或/ 4 +或- 5 & 6
1.1 公式中的运算符 运算符优先级 优先级 运算种类 1 % 2 ^ 3 *或/ 4 +或- 5 & 6 比较运算符(=、>、<……) IBM Confidential
7
第一章 函数的基础知识 1.2 单元格的引用 相对引用 相对引用指公式中的单元格位置将随着公式单元格的位置而改变,如A4 绝对引用 混合引用
1.2 单元格的引用 相对引用 相对引用指公式中的单元格位置将随着公式单元格的位置而改变,如A4 绝对引用 绝对引用是指公式和函数中的位置是固定不变的. 绝对引用是在列字母和行数字之前都加上美元符号”$”,如$A$4,$C$6 混合引用 混合引用是指在一个单元格引用中,既有绝对引用,也有相对引用. 例:行变列不变:$A4 列变行不变:A$4 小窍门:引用方式之间的快速切换 在输入公式的过程中,选定单元格,重复按“F4”,单元格号就会发生以下变化:“A2”→“$A$2”→“A$2”→“$A2” IBM Confidential
8
第一章 函数的基础知识 1.2 单元格的引用 当前工作表之外的引用 引用格式:工作表名称!单元格地址。 多个工作薄中的引用
单元格的引用 当前工作表之外的引用 引用格式:工作表名称!单元格地址。 多个工作薄中的引用 引用格式:[工作薄名称]工作表名!数据源地址 说明:以上两种引用形式一般是直接所需要引用的单元格,格式就会自动生成。 IBM Confidential
9
第一章 函数的基础知识 1.3 函数的输入与编辑 输入函数 修改函数 删除函数 使用“插入函数”对话框
函数的输入与编辑 输入函数 使用“插入函数”对话框 直接输入函数:使用编辑栏;直接在单元格中输入 修改函数 在编辑栏或单元格中直接修改 删除函数 单个单元格函数的删除:Backspace或Delete 多个单元格函数的删除:Delete IBM Confidential
10
第一章 函数的基础知识 1.4 函数的分类 函数类型 函数符号 逻辑函数 IF、AND、OR、NOT 数学函数
函数的分类 函数类型 函数符号 逻辑函数 IF、AND、OR、NOT 数学函数 SUM、PRODUCT、INT、ROUND、ABS、 统计函数 COUNT、AVERAGE、RANK、MAX、MIN 日期函数 DATE、TIME、TODAY、NOW、DATEDIF 文本函数 LEFT、RIGHT、MID、LEN、CONTATENATE、TEXT、REPLACE 查找与引用函数 VLOOKUP、LOOKUP IBM Confidential
11
第二章 常用函数的应用技巧 2.1 逻辑函数 2.2 数学函数 2.3 统计函数 2.4 日期函数 2.5 文本函数 2.6 查找与引用函数
12
2.1 逻辑函数 IF函数: 功能:执行真假值判断,根据逻辑测试的真假值返回不同的结果
2.1 逻辑函数 IF函数: 功能:执行真假值判断,根据逻辑测试的真假值返回不同的结果 格式: IF(Logical_test,Value_if_true,Value_if_false) AND函数: 功能:指定的多个条件式全部成立,则返回TRUE。 格式: : AND(Logical1,Logical2,...) OR函数: 功能:指定的多个条件式中一个或一个以上的条件成立,则返还TRUE。 格式: OR(Logical1,Logical2,...) NOT函数: 功能:指定条件式不成立,则返回TRUE。 格式: NOT(Logical) IBM Confidential
13
2.2 数学函数 SUM函数: 功能:计算单元格区域中所有数值的和 格式: SUM(Number1,Number2,...)
2.2 数学函数 SUM函数: 功能:计算单元格区域中所有数值的和 格式: SUM(Number1,Number2,...) SUMIF函数: 功能:对满足单一指定条件的单元格求和 格式: SUMIF(Range,Criteria,Sum_range) SUMIFS函数: 功能:对满足多个指定条件的单元格求和 格式: S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...) PRODUCT函数: 功能:计算所有参数的乘积 格式:PRODUCT(Number1,Number2,...) SUMPRODUCT 函数: 功能1:①将数组中对应的元素相乘,并返回乘积之和; 格式:SUMPRODUCT(array1,array2,array3, ...) 功能2:用于计算符合2个及以上条件的数据个数(与COUNTIFS函数功能类似); 格式:SUMPRODUCT(条件1*条件2*……) 功能3:用于计算符合多个条件的数据求和(与SUMIFS函数功能类似); 格式: SUMPRODUCT(条件1*条件2*……,求和数据区域). IBM Confidential
14
2.2 数学函数 INT函数: 功能:对数值向下取整 格式:INT(Number) ABS 函数: 功能:求数值的绝对值
2.2 数学函数 INT函数: 功能:对数值向下取整 格式:INT(Number) ABS 函数: 功能:求数值的绝对值 格式: ABS(number) ROUND函数: 功能:按指定位数对数值四舍五入 格式: ROUND(Number,Num_digits) 参数: 位数 四舍五入的位置 正数 n 在小数点后第n+1位进行四舍五入 在小数点后第1位进行四舍五入 负数 n 在整数第n位四舍五入 省略位数 不能省略 IBM Confidential
15
2.3 统计函数 COUNT函数: 功能:计算数值数据的个数 格式:COUNT((Number1,Number2,...)
2.3 统计函数 COUNT函数: 功能:计算数值数据的个数 格式:COUNT((Number1,Number2,...) COUNTA函数: 功能:计算指定单元格区域中非空单元格的个数,包含文本或逻辑值。 格式:COUNTA(Value1,Value2,...) COUNTBLANK函数: 功能:计算空白单元格的个数 格式: COUNTBLANK(Range) COUNTIF函数: 功能:计算满足指定条件的数据个数 格式: COUNTIF(Range,Criteria) COUNTIFS函数: 功能:计算多个区域中满足给定条件的单元格的个数。 格式: COUNTIFS(criteria_range1,criteria1,criteria_range2,criteria2,…) 备注:COUNT与COUNTA函数的区别之处在于,COUNTA函数中数值以外的文本或逻辑值可以算作统计数据的个数。 IBM Confidential
16
2.3 统计函数 AVERAGE函数: 功能:计算参数的平均值 格式: AVERAGE(Number1,Number2,...)
2.3 统计函数 AVERAGE函数: 功能:计算参数的平均值 格式: AVERAGE(Number1,Number2,...) AVERAGEA函数: 功能:计算参数列表中非空单元格中数值的平均值求参数的平均值 格式: AVERAGEA(Value1,Value2,...) AVERAGEIF函数: 功能:计算某个区域内满足给定条件的所有单元格的平均值 格式: AVERAGEIF(Range,Criteria,Average_range) AVERAGEIFS函数: 功能:计算满足多个给定条件的所有单元格的平均值 格式: AVERAGEIFS(所求平均值区域,区域1,条件1,区域2,条件2……) 演示一下AVERAGE和AVERAGEA函数的区别 IBM Confidential
17
2.3 统计函数 RANK函数: 功能:返回一个数值在一组数值中的排位 格式: RANK(nubmer,ref,order)
2.3 统计函数 RANK函数: 功能:返回一个数值在一组数值中的排位 格式: RANK(nubmer,ref,order) 参数: nubmer:指定需找到排位的数值或者数值所在的单元格; ref:指定包含数值的单元格区域或者区域名称; order:指明排位的方式,1代表升序,0代表降序,如果省略则用降序排位。 MAX函数: 功能:返回一组值中的最大值 格式: MAX(Number1,Number2,...) MIN函数: 功能:返回一组值中的最小值 格式: MIN(Number1,Number2,...) 演示一下AVERAGE和AVERAGEA函数的区别 IBM Confidential
18
2.4 日期函数 类别 函数 格式 功能 当前日期 TODAY TODAY() 返回当前的日期 NOW NOW() 返回当前的日期和时间
2.4 日期函数 类别 函数 格式 功能 当前日期 TODAY TODAY() 返回当前的日期 NOW NOW() 返回当前的日期和时间 用序列号表示日期 YEAR YEAR(Serial_number) 返回某日期序对应的年份数 MONTH MONTH(Serial_number) 返回某日期对应的月份数 DAY DAY(Serial_number) 返回某日期对应的月份数中的日序数 WEEKDAY WEEKDAY(serial_number,return_type) 返回某日期的星期数。 特定日期的序列号 DATE DATE(Year,Month,Day) 求以年、月、日表示的日期的序列号 TIME TIME(hour,minute,second) 返回特定时间的序列号 期间差 DATEDIF DATEDIF(start_date,end_date,unit) 用指定的单位计算两个日期之间的天数 DATEDIF代码说明: Y:两个日期之间间隔的年数;M:两个日期之间间隔的月数;D:两个日期之间间隔的天数; YM:两个日期之间的月份,不计年分差;YD:两个日期之间间隔的天数,忽略年数;MD:两个日期之间不计年份和月份的天。 WEEKDAY函数返回值:在默认情况下,它的值为1(星期天)到7(星期六)之间的一个整数。serial_number 是要返回日期数的日期,return_type为确定返回值类型的数字,数字1 或省略则1 至7 代表星期天到星期六,数字2 则1 至7 代表星期一到星期天,数字3则0至6代表星期一到星期天。 备注:DATEDIF函数代码说明 Y:两个日期之间间隔的年数;M:两个日期之间间隔的月数;D:两个日期之间间隔的天数; YM:两个日期之间的月份,不计年分差;YD:两个日期之间间隔的天数,忽略年数; MD:两个日期之间不计年份和月份的天。 IBM Confidential
19
2.5 文本函数 类别 函数 格式 功能 提取部分文本字符串 LEFT LEFT(Text,Num_chars)
2.5 文本函数 类别 函数 格式 功能 提取部分文本字符串 LEFT LEFT(Text,Num_chars) 从一个文本字符串的第一个字符开始返回指定个数的字符 RIGHT RIGHT(Text,Num_chars) 从字符串的最后一个字符开始返回指定字符数的字符 MID MID(Text,Start_num,Num_chars) 从字符串中指定的位置起返回指定长度的字符 文本长度 LEN LEN(Text) 返回文本字符串的字符数 合并文本 CONTATENATE CONTATENATE(Text1,Text2,……) 将多个文本字符合并成一个 数字转换为文本 TEXT TEXT(Value,Format_text) 将数值转换为按指定数值格式表示的文本 替代文本字符串 REPLACE REPLACE(Old_text,Start_num,Num_chars,New_text) 按照指定的字符位置和字节数,将指定的字符串替换为另一个文本字符串 SUBSTITUTE SUBSTITUTE(Text,Old_text,New_text,Instance_num) 用新字符串替换字符窜中的部分字符串。 演示一下REPLACE和SUBSTITUTE函数区别. SUBSTITUTE函数中的参数instance_num 为一数值,用来指定以new_text 替换第几次出现的old_text;如果指定了instance_num,则只有满足要求的old_text 被替换;否则将用new_text 替换Text 中出现的所有old_text。 备注:REPLACE和SUBSTITUTE函数区别 如果需要在某一文本字符串中替换指定的文本,请使用函数 SUBSTITUTE; 如果需要在某一文本字符串中替换指定位置处的任意文本,请使用函数REPLACE。 IBM Confidential
20
2.6 查找与引用函数 VLOOKUP函数: 功能:在首列查找数值,并返回当前行中指定列处的数值。
2.6 查找与引用函数 VLOOKUP函数: 功能:在首列查找数值,并返回当前行中指定列处的数值。 格式: VLOOKUP(Lookup_value,Table_array,Col_index_num,Range_lookup) 参数: ①需要查找的数值;②指定查找范围;③返回匹配值得列序号;④用TRUE或FALSE指定查找方法。如果为TRUE或省略,则返回近似匹配值;如果为FALSE或0,则返回精确匹配值,如果找不到,则返回错误值“#N/A”。 HLOOKUP函数: 功能:在首行查找数值,并返回当前列中指定行处的数值。 格式: HLOOKUP(Lookup_value,Table_array,Row_index_num,Range_lookup) LOOKUP函数(向量形式) 功能:在向量中查找一个值 格式: LOOKUP(lookup_value,lookup_vector,result_vector) VLOOKUP函数(数组形式): 功能:在数组中查找一个值 格式: LOOKUP(lookup_value,array) 向量是指含一行或一列的区域,LOOKUP函数的向量型是指在单行区域或单列区域(成为“向量”)中查找值,然后返回第二个单行区域或单列区域中相同位置的值。数组型是在第一行或第一列中查找指定数值,然后返回最后一行或最后一列中相同位置处得数值。 IBM Confidential
21
卓越服务 快乐生活 THANK YOU ! 20% 战略功能
Similar presentations